Description

The National Institute of Standards and Technology (NIST) Quantum Information Group applies expertise in mathematical subdisciplines such as combinatorics, graph theory, network science, operations research, optimization, discrete nonlinear dynamics, computational geometry, quantum mechanics, and information theory. Researchers apply their knowledge and skills in areas such as experimental quantum optics, fundamental models of physics, chemistry, biology, and information systems, complex systems analysis, pattern recognition, and quantum computing and communications. In collaboration with NIST and outside scientists, the group develops, analyzes, and applies related mathematical and experimental methods and tools for critical problems of measurement science at NIST, and develops mathematical foundations for the measurement science of information systems.



The purpose of this acquisition is to obtain two (2) Superconducting Nanowire Single Photon Detectors (SNSPDs) for Quantum Networking Metrology, manufactured by Quantum Opus. The SNSPDs will be installed by Quantum Opus into our existing 2.2 K moveable cryostats, which were manufactured by Quantum Opus, LLC. One SNSPD will be installed in each of the two existing cryostats. The detectors will serve to detect 795 nm photons from a Rubidium vapor source, ultimately allowing entanglement swapping demonstrations in the Washington Metropolitan Quantum Network Research Consortium (DC-Qnet).



Technical Specifications: The contractor shall provide two SNSPDs in accordance with the following Technical Specifications as the minimum requirements:

• SNSPDs shall operate and plateau at a cryostat temperature of 2.2 K.

• System detection efficiency of at least 90 % at 780 nm.

• Dark count rates less than 100/sec

• SNSPDs shall be fiber coupled 780HP fiber with E2000 connector.

• Timing jitter shall be less than 20 ps full-width-half-maximum (FWHM).

• Capable of being fitted into existing Quantum Opus cryostats.

• Existing cryostats shall be upgraded with the latest Biasing and Amplification electronics to optimize integration with the 2 SNSPDs



Sole Source Determination

The sole source determination is based on the following:



NIST requires the SNSPDs manufactured by Quantum Opus for purposes of continuity of science and compatibility with existing equipment and previous research results. Without the subject supply, NIST would not be able to further its quantum networking measurement capabilities with the DC-QNet and other collaborative efforts. The SNSPDs will run continuous operations of single photon detection without interruption. Without this capability, NIST research will be severely impacted and risk not obtaining single-photon measurements. In order to develop the necessary metrology to enable complex quantum networks, SNSPDs need to be compatible with existing cryostats manufactured by Quantum Opus, LLC and to further the continuity of science.
